Ricky has Dysthymia, which is a chronic type of depression in which a person's moods are regularly low. The main symptom of dysthymia is a low, dark, or sad mood on most days for at least 2 years. In addition, two or more of the following symptoms will be present almost all of the time that the person has dysthymia:
•Feelings of hopelessness
•Too little or too much sleep
•Low energy or fatigue
•Low self-esteem
•Poor appetite or overeating
•Poor concentration
The exact cause of Dysthymia is unknown, but it tends to run in families. Ricky's mother had schizophrenia and passed away at 46. Ricky was raised in Nesbit Courts (a housing project) for a while and then went to foster care, where he was cruelly abused.
